Released exclusively for the PlayStation Portable (PSP) in the early 2010s, Nippon Ageruyo was Sony Japan’s answer to life simulation mania. The premise is deceptively simple: you are a supernatural entity (a cross between a guardian angel and a real estate agent) tasked with making a single Japanese citizen—your "client"—supremely happy.
